Bluetooth Development for Embedded Systems: Wi-Fi & Arduino is a course on building wireless embedded applications using Bluetooth alongside Wi-Fi and Arduino-based platforms published by Udemy Online Academy. This is a hands-on, hands-on course designed to help learners build wireless embedded applications using Bluetooth alongside Wi-Fi and Arduino-based platforms. The course explains how Bluetooth works at the embedded level and shows how to design, configure, and program Bluetooth-enabled microcontrollers for real-world communication tasks. Students will gain experience integrating Bluetooth with sensors, actuators, and Wi-Fi connectivity, enabling device control, data exchange, and IoT-style applications.
By focusing on real-world implementations rather than just theory, this course equips students with the skills needed to create reliable and efficient wireless embedded systems. This course is designed for embedded systems engineers and serious enthusiasts who want to master Bluetooth (classic) and Wi-Fi communications from the ground up, moving on to advanced protocol validation and device analysis. This in-depth course focuses on providing the theoretical foundations and practical skills needed to design, implement, and debug robust wireless applications. You will work extensively with the popular ESP32 microcontroller and the Arduino framework.
What you will learn in Bluetooth Development for Embedded Systems: Wi-Fi & Arduino:
- Design robust embedded systems by mastering classic Bluetooth and Wi-Fi transceiver architectures.
- Analyze Bluetooth channel hopping, frequency dynamics, and range estimation for optimal performance.
- Set up a complete Arduino development environment and properly connect multiple ESP32 boards.
- Develop a complete, advanced Bluetooth scanner application on an embedded system.
- Implement distance estimation algorithms and perform device threat analysis in the scanner.
- Extract and process vendor-specific MAC addresses for device identification and tracking.
- Apply the “protocol-first philosophy” to network engineering and embedded development.
- Program the ESP32 for SPP telemetry and command management using classic Bluetooth protocols.
- Validate live protocol data using Host Controller Interface (HCI) analysis techniques.
- Master complex wireless protocol validation for L2CAP, SPP, and other core network layers.
